Rez, Rezzer, Rezzing - To Rez is usually a verb that means to generate or to create an object seem in Second Life. Rezzing an item/prim can be carried out by dragging goods from a stock or by generating them in straight by way of the edit window. A scripted object that rezzes other objects, for example molecules, is referred to as a rezzer. The phrase comes from the science-fiction Motion picture Tron. Sim - In Second Life a sim (simulation, much more accurately area) can be a named 256 m by 256 m location of land hosted by one simulator approach.
